Gather 'round and listen for a spell Got another story I must tell Pulled it from the wires and the air A tangled knot of hope and of despair I heard it on the wind in Atlanta town And from the highest court as word came down Just another chapter, worn and old A tale of power, bought and sold. Oh, the headlines roll on like a thundercloud Spoken soft and shouted way too loud But you strip away the date and all the names
You're left with just the same old human games A song of fear, a ballad of the fight I'm just here to sing it in the fading light. Two old men stood underneath the glare With a silent nation holding to a prayer One man's voice was faltering and low A river struggling for a place to flow The other swung with words as sharp as stone About a kingdom he once called his own They talked of numbers, borders, and disease While a worried country rustled like the trees.
Oh, the headlines roll on like a thundercloud Spoken soft and shouted way too loud But you strip away the date and all the names You're left with just the same old human games A song of fear, a ballad of the fight I'm just here to sing it in the fading light. Then the gavels fell on a marble hill Making laws the way they always will For a soul in Idaho who's losing blood Caught between a law and what is good And for the weary man with no place for his head
Now it's a crime to make the street his bed From the highest halls to the gutters deep Promises are things they never keep. Oh, the headlines roll on like a thundercloud Spoken soft and shouted way too loud But you strip away the date and all the names You're left with just the same old human games A song of fear, a ballad of the fight I'm just here to sing it in the fading light.
